Understanding Door Panel Refurbishment
Door panel refurbishment involves the repair and enhancement of existing door panels to enhance their look and functionality. This process can include cleansing, repairing damages, repainting, and refinishing. Depending upon the condition of the door, repair can extend its lifespan and conserve homeowners money compared to acquiring new doors.

The Refurbishment Process
The door panel repair procedure can vary depending upon the material and condition of the door. Below is a basic overview of the actions involved:
| Step | Description |
|---|---|
| Assessment | Inspect the door for damages, wear, or aesthetic concerns. |
| Cleaning up | Remove dirt, dust, and any existing surfaces using appropriate cleaning options. |
| Repairs | Repair any damages, such as cracks, dents, or scratches, using fillers or replacement parts. |
| Sanding | Sand the door panel to prepare it for refinishing, ensuring a smooth surface for painting. |
| Painting | Apply guide and paint or stain according to the wanted finish, permitting for drying time. |
| Sealing | Use a protective sealant to boost durability and durability against the aspects. |
| Hardware | Change or recondition hardware (handles, hinges, etc) to match the make over of the door. |
Materials Commonly Used in Door Panels
Door panels can be made from a variety of products, each with its own repair strategies. Here's a list of some common materials and their refurbishment methods:
| Material | Repair Method |
|---|---|
| Wood | Sanding, staining, and varnishing to bring back natural appeal. |
| Metal | Cleaning with rust remover and repainting to prevent rust. |
| Fiberglass | Cleaning and painting; avoid heavy abrasion to maintain surface area stability. |
| Composite | Repairing with fillers and painting to maintain look. |
